WordPerfect Mail review

6.7

Editors' Rating

Good

7.8

Members' Rating

Very Good

Typical price:£ 40

Verdict

WordPerfect Mail is an inexpensive yet powerful email client that's good for small businesses on tight budgets. Its IMAP support needs work, but it's a fine alternative to Microsoft Outlook, Netscape, Eudora and other competitors... Read Full Review.

Pros

  • Clear interface is easy to learn
  • Good calendar, search, RSS newsreader and spam-blocking tools

Cons

  • Poor IMAP support
  • Phone help is expensive
